WebHR data shows as general HR and resting HR data from the Garmin devices, though. Basically, Garmin and Apple are both "walled gardens" and their devices don't play nice together. I've given up pulling most data into Health, and use Garmin Connect as my primary fitness source (I've got 14 years of data there, so it's my "source of truth" anyway). WebTo set up the Venu® 2 series watch, it must be paired directly through the Garmin Connect™ app, instead of from the Bluetooth ® settings on your phone. During the initial setup on your watch, select when you are prompted to pair with your phone. NOTE: If you previously skipped the pairing process, you can hold , and select > Connectivity ...
